WebNov 24, 2024 · American households had an average bank account balance of $41,600 in 2024, according to data from the Federal Reserve. The median bank account balance is $5,300 according to the same data.Bank account balances in this analysis include checking, savings, and money market accounts held by American households. Bank of America account holders can exchange foreign currency (no coins) for U.S. dollars at a … WebThe answer to this question, of course is yes if you are receiving Social Security Disability. If you are receiving SSI, the answer is no, because you are not allowed to have assets over $2000. So you couldn’t even have an account with this much in it without becoming ineligible for SSI.
